Understanding the Role of Condition
The condition of your Galaxy S22 Plus is often the most significant determinant of its trade-in value. This includes the physical appearance, screen integrity, and overall functionality. Devices that are free from cracks, dents, and scratches typically fetch higher offers.
Key aspects of condition include:
- Screen condition: No cracks or deep scratches
- Body integrity: No dents or deep scuffs
- Functionality: All features, buttons, and sensors work properly
- Battery health: Good battery life with minimal degradation
Impact of Features and Specifications
While condition is crucial, the features and specifications of your Galaxy S22 Plus also influence its trade-in value. This includes storage capacity, color, and any unique features that may add to its desirability.
Notable features that can enhance value include:
- Higher storage options (128GB, 256GB, 512GB)
- Color variants that are in demand
- Additional accessories or original packaging
- Unlocked devices compatible with multiple carriers
Which Matters More: Condition or Features?
In most cases, condition outweighs features when determining trade-in value. A pristine device with minimal wear will generally receive a better offer than a heavily used device with top-tier features. However, if your device has rare or highly sought-after specifications, it can offset some condition issues.
For example, a Galaxy S22 Plus with 512GB storage in excellent condition will likely be valued higher than a 128GB model with visible scratches. Conversely, a device with minor cosmetic flaws but the highest storage and latest features might still command a good trade-in value.
